But before we jump into the list of interior design trends for Hyderabad homes, here are some design aesthetics that are common in the city:
“This year Hyderabadi homes will be a lot about contemporary interiors. We see people are moving towards modern and functional designs. Other than that, wooden elements with royal decorative aesthetics will remain popular in the city. You will also see a lot of wood and mirror paneling in Hyderabadi home interiors in the coming season,” says Gangishetty Akhitha, Senior Designer, Design Cafe Hyderabad.
Traditional Style Living Room With A Modern Twist!
As mentioned above, Hyderabadis love traditionally styled interiors but with a modern twist. It’s the minute details that create magic. Step into any home in this city and you will be welcomed with antique accents, wooden furniture vibrant colours and some drama! The city is a melting pot of big families as well as young techie couples buying and designing their dream houses. This blending of two generations has given birth to a style that’s an elegant balance of traditional and modern interiors. See this image that beautifully tells you what a typical living room in Hyderabad looks like. We see a centre table, a sideboard made out of wood balanced by a massive back panel in marble, a false ceiling with cove lighting that binds this space together.

A Bedroom Where Comfort Meets Royalty!
A subtle yet upscale, elegant bedroom but one that is not flashy, Hyderabadis wish to sleep like the Nizams but not without the comforts of modern times in their master bedrooms. Sleek designs with sophisticated accents and decor is the blueprint of an ideal master bedroom that you will find in the city of young millionaires.
A rich false ceiling design with recessed lights, copper inlays, wood flooring, mirrors and glass play together adding a touch of royalty to this bedroom. Look closely, this bedroom will not make your eyes clinch but make your jaws drop in awe!

A Contemporary Kitchen So Perfect, Just Like Hyderabadi Biryani!
Spacious kitchens designed with modern functionalities for all chefs in the family is what we are talking about! Also, Hyderabadis give utmost importance to Vastu when it comes to designing a home and a kitchen is certainly not left out when it comes to abiding with the principles of this science. This means water and fire elements must not face each other as they are opposing in nature. Notice how the hob unit and sink are perpendicular to each other? Yes, this is the secret ingredient to a happy, harmonious home!

Don’t Worry! We Haven’t Forgotten The Pooja Unit!
A pooja unit is a must have element in the interior design of any home Hyderabad! It exhibits the belief of Hindu families that no matter how progressive and modern their lives are, they still follow their traditions to the core. A typical pooja unit in a Hyderabadi home is simple, made from wood, marble (as a backsplash or countertop) with just the right amount of lighting on the idol. Doors with brass hanging bells, jaalis (latticed screens), and intricate detailing is commonplace in these homes.
